Java วิธี Query Field CLOB จาก Oracle  สร้างคำถาม

 2,393 view  หมวดหมู่ : สำหรับโปรแกรมเมอร์  วันที่สร้าง : 07/09/2018

Java วิธี Query Field CLOB จาก Oracle

ตัวอย่างการ Query field CLOB จาก Oracle ด้วย Java
ก่อนอื่นเราก็ select ข้อมูลด้วย JDBC ปรกตินะครับ เช่น

select f_clob from test_clob

พอได้ข้อมูลที่เป็น clob ออกมาจาก result set แล้วมันยังไม่เป็น String นะครับ
นอกซะจากเราจะแปลมาก่อนจาก SQL เช่นใช้คำสั่ง พวก dbms_lob.substr(f_clob)
แต่ถ้าไม่ได้แปลงค่าอะไรเราก็จะได้ข้อมูลออกมาเป็น clob ครับ
ซึ่งจะต้องเอามาทำการแปลงค่าก่อน ด้วย function ตัวอย่าง ประมาณนี้


public static String clobToStr(Clob clobField) {
InputStream inptSrm = null;
String strClobToStr = "";
try {
if (clobField != null) {
inptSrm = null;
inptSrm = clobField.getAsciiStream();
StringBuffer strBuffClob = new StringBuffer();
int chr;
while ((chr = inptSrm.read()) != -1) {
strBuffClob.append((char) chr);
}
strClobToStr = strBuffClob.toString();
inptSrm.close();
}
} catch (Exception eException) {

}
return strClobToStr;
}

ตอนใช้งานเราก็ทำการเรียกใช้ function แล้วส่งค่า field CLOB เข้ามา


ถ้าชอบบทความนี้ กด Like เลย :Java วิธี Query Field CLOB จาก Oracle
TAGS : Java   Oracle   CLOB   Programmer   เขียนโปรแกรม  
 2,393 view  หมวดหมู่ : สำหรับโปรแกรมเมอร์  วันที่สร้าง : 07/09/2018



SOA,Java,XSLT

 ร่วมแสดงความคิดเห็นได้ที่นี่




× แจ้งเตือน! เราสนับสนุนทุกความคิดเห็น ที่ ใช้ถ้อยคำสุภาพ ไม่ละเมิดผู้อื่น ไม่ก่อให้เกิดความขัดแย้ง

เนื้อหาที่เกี่ยวช้อง

  java mbean คือ อะไรครับ ใช้ทำอะไรได้บ้าง ถามเมื่อ (2015-08-28)   3,819 views  (ดูล่าสุดเมื่อ 3 นาที)

  Oracle INSTR SQL Function ตัวนี้ใช้งานยังไง มาดูกัน ถามเมื่อ (2020-02-06)   8,698 views  (ดูล่าสุดเมื่อ 35 นาที)

  PLSQL Replace String ด้วยคำสั่ง REGEXP_REPLACE ถามเมื่อ (2016-11-29)   2,778 views  (ดูล่าสุดเมื่อ 40 นาที)

  Ireport เทคนิคการทำแบบฟอร์มด้วย Image Background ถามเมื่อ (2018-12-18)   2,618 views  (ดูล่าสุดเมื่อ 66 นาที)

  พอร์ต RS 232 คืออะไร ใช้ทำอะไร เราสามารถเรียกได้อีกอย่างว่าอะไร ถามเมื่อ (2011-08-01)   3,695 views  (ดูล่าสุดเมื่อ 67 นาที)

  Oracle การ join โดยใช้ select ซ้อน select แบบมากกว่า 2 ชุด ถามเมื่อ (2017-03-03)   2,793 views  (ดูล่าสุดเมื่อ 101 นาที)

  PLSQL วิธี Fetch ข้อมูลใน Cursor แบบต่างๆ ถามเมื่อ (2020-02-28)   5,378 views  (ดูล่าสุดเมื่อ 103 นาที)

  ถามเกี่ยวกับ Spring mvc ค่ะว่า formview successview มันเรียกใช้ตอนใหน ถามเมื่อ (2015-08-23)   2,399 views  (ดูล่าสุดเมื่อ 111 นาที)

  ไฟล์แบบ WebP ดีอย่างไร ถามเมื่อ (2020-01-29)   3,053 views  (ดูล่าสุดเมื่อ 135 นาที)

  ตัวอย่าง javascript สลับ ซ่อน แล้ว แสดง โดยใช้ div style value ถามเมื่อ (2013-08-28)   3,896 views  (ดูล่าสุดเมื่อ 141 นาที)


 

บ้านเดียวกันดอทคอม เว็บถามตอบ รวมทุกเรื่องที่คุณอยากรู้ ให้ความรู้ ความบันเทิง มีสาระ
www.ban1gun.com